Why I’m Slightly Annoyed by the Wagering Terms

Okay, I’ll be honest. The 35x wagering on the rainbow casino no deposit bonus for new players UK is fine. But it’s not the best I’ve ever seen. PlayOJO, for example, offers no wagering on some of their bonuses. But they don’t always have a no deposit offer. So you’re trading off.

Here’s the breakdown. If you get £10 free, you need to wager £350 before you can withdraw anything. That’s not hard if you’re playing slots with a high RTP. But if you’re playing table games, the contribution is lower. Usually around 10% to 20%. So be smart about it. Stick to slots.

Also, there’s a max bet limit. Usually £5 per spin while the bonus is active. If you bet more, they void the bonus. It’s written in the terms. Don’t ignore it. I’ve seen people lose their winnings because they didn’t read the fine print.
